I just learned that originally the current US led expedition in Iraq was called Operation Iraqi Liberation (OIL). Strangely enough Karl Rove quickly had that changed to Operation Iraqi Freedom – a deft move, Karl.
In this article by Greg Palast I also learned that “…the five largest oil companies pulled in $113 billion in profit in 2005 — compared to a piddly $34 billion in 2002 before Operation Iraqi Liberation.” The price of oil is up 371% since Clinton smoked cigars in the egg room and OPEC are very happy chappies (the price of oil is up 148% since early 2002). It seems there were two plans developed for post-war Iraq, one to privatise the oil industry and the other to control it. The control option won, Iraq plays nice with OPEC and everyone prospers. Well, everyone in the oil business anyway.
